Given below are two statements:

Statement I: A genetic algorithm is a stochastic hill-climbing search in which a large population of states is maintained.

Statement II: In nondeterministic environments, agents can apply AND-OR search to generate contingent plans that reach the goal regardless of which outcomes occur during execution.

In the light of the above statements, choose the Correct answer from the options given below

  1. Both Statement I and Statement II are true
  2. Both Statement I and Statement II are false
  3. Statement I is correct but Statement II is false
  4. Statement I is incorrect but Statement II is true

Answer (Detailed Solution Below)

Option 1 : Both Statement I and Statement II are true

The correct answer is option 1.

Key Points

A genetic algorithm is a stochastic hill-climbing algorithm that maintains a wide population of states. Mutation and crossover, which blends pairs of states from the population, create new states.

Hence Statement I is correct.

Agents may use AND-OR search in non-deterministic environments to produce contingent plans that achieve the target regardless of which outcomes occur during execution.

Hence Statement II is correct

Additional Information

  • AND-OR search trees: 
    • ​OR nodes: The only branching in a deterministic setting is implemented by the agent's own choices in each state; we call these nodes OR nodes.
    • AND nodes: Branching is often implemented in a non-deterministic setting by the environment's choice of outcome for each action, which we call nodes AND nodes.
